﻿/*Table of content*/

/*Desktop Media*/

/*Desktop height media*/

/*1024-iPad Landscape, iPad Pro Portrait*/

/*992-Tablet*/

/*980-Tablet*/

/*960-Tablet*/

/*854-Nokia N9 Landscape*/

/*823-Pixel 2 XL Landscape*/

/*812-iPhone X Landscape*/

/*800-Kindle Fire HDX, Nexux 10*/

/*768-iPad Portrait*/

/*736-iPhone 6/7/8 Plus Landscape*/

/*731-Pixel 2 Landscape*/

/*667-iPhone 6/7/8 Landscape*/

/*640-Galaxy Note 3 Landscape*/

/*604-Smartphone*/

/*600-Blackberry PlayBook, Nexus 7*/

/*586-iPhone 5/SE Landscape*/

/*533-Nokia Lumia 520 Landscape*/

/*480-Nokia N9*/

/*414-iPhone 6/7/8 Plus*/

/*412-Nexus 6*/

/*411-Pixel 2XL*/

/*384-LG Optimus L70, Nexus 4*/

/*375-iPhone 6/7/8 Plus, iPhone X*/

/*360-Galaxy S5, Galaxy Note, Galaxy Note 3, Nexus 5, BlackBerry, Microsoft Lumia*/

/*320-iPhone 5/SE, iPhone 4, Nokia Lumia 520*/

/**/

@media only screen and (min-width:1921px) {

}
@media only screen and (max-width:1680px) {
    .rightbottomobject{width: 400px;}
    .loginfrm {padding: 0px 70px;}
    
}
@media only screen and (max-width:1600px) {
  

}
@media only screen and (max-width:1440px) {
    .mb-150{margin-bottom: 100px;}
    .tabletabpanel .table .form-control{min-width: 40px;}
    .titlereg{margin-bottom: 0px;}
   .registerfrom .form-group{margin-bottom: 10px;}
   .registerfrom .loingbtn{margin-top: 10px;}
   .regvector.mb-50{margin-bottom: 20px;}
    .registerowsection {align-items: flex-start;height: inherit;}
    .registerfrom{padding-left: 80px;}
    .registercol{padding: 70px 0px;}
}

@media only screen and (max-width:1366px) {
    
}

@media only screen and (max-width:1280px) {
    
    
}
@media only screen and (min-width: 1280px) and (max-width: 1441px) {
    
    

}
@media only screen and (min-width: 1280px) and (max-width: 1365px) {
    .footermain h4{font-size: 16px;}
    
    
}
@media only screen and (min-width: 1224px) and (max-width: 1279px) {}

@media only screen and (min-width: 1200px) and (max-width: 1223px) {}

@media only screen and (min-width: 1152px) and (max-width: 1199px) {}

@media only screen and (max-width:1199px) {
    
}

@media only screen and (max-width:1152px) {}

/*Desktop Media Ends*/

/*Desktop height media Starts*/

@media (min-width:1200px) and (max-width:1280px) and (max-height: 1024px) {}

@media (min-width:1200px) and (max-width:1280px) and (max-height: 960px) {}

@media (min-width:1200px) and (max-width:1280px) and (max-height: 800px) {}

@media (min-width:1200px) and (max-width:1280px) and (max-height: 768px) {}
@media only screen and (min-width:1200px)  {

}

/*Desktop height media Ends*/

/*iPad Landscape, iPad Pro Portrait start*/
@media only screen and (max-width:1200px) {

}
@media only screen and (max-width:1199px) {
   .topbuttonpanel .mr-10{margin-right: 5px;}   
   .topbuttonpanel .ml-10{margin-left: 0px; margin-right: 5px;}
   .logo{width: 150px;} 
   .rightcolacount .ml-30 {margin-left: 20px;}
   .noti-icon-col .dropdown-toggle{padding: 25px 0px;} 
   .navbar{margin-top: 70px;padding: 12px 0px;}
   .mobiletoggle{display: flex;flex-wrap: wrap;justify-content: space-between; vertical-align: middle;width: 100%;}
   .navbar .collapse:not(.show) {display: inline-block;}
   .navbar-collapse{position: fixed;z-index: 30;padding: 50px 40px;  right: 0px; top: 0px;transform: translateX(100%);
    transition: all 0.3s ease;background-color: #b9ad91;height: 100%;width: 40%;}
   .navbar-collapse.show{transform: none;} 
   .navbar-light .navbar-nav .nav-item:first-child .nav-link{padding-left: 15px;}
   button:focus:not(:focus-visible){box-shadow: none;}
   .navbar-light .navbar-toggler{border: none;padding: 0px;}
   .navbar-light .navbar-nav .nav-link{border-bottom: 1px solid #d6cfba;padding: 10px 0px !important;}
   .navbar-light .navbar-nav .dropdown-menu{padding: 0px 15px 0px;}
   .navbar-light .navbar-nav .dropdown .dropdown-toggle{display: flex;align-items: center;justify-content: space-between;}
   .navbar-light .navbar-nav .dropdown .dropdown-toggle.show::after{transform: rotate(180deg);}
   .navbar-light .navbar-nav .dropdown-menu .dropdown-item{padding: 10px 0px;}
   .closemenu{display: inline-block;}
    body{background-size: 300px;}
   .docid strong, .uplodBox-lg label strong{font-size: 14px;}
   .leftcolumn{margin-top: 30px;}
   .infodetailright ul{display: flex;margin: 0px -15px;flex-wrap: wrap;}
   .infodetailright ul li{width: 33.33%;padding: 0px 15px;}
   .container-fluid{padding: 0px 20px;}
   .infodetailright ul li:last-child .infoborder{border-bottom:1px solid #ddd;margin-bottom: 15px;padding-bottom: 15px;}
   .padall-30.infodetailright{padding-bottom: 15px;}
   .uplodBox-lg label{min-height: inherit;}
   .radiobox-inline .form-check {margin-right: 50px;}
   .nav-pills li{margin-bottom: 10px;}
    .nav-pills .nav-link{padding: 6px 10px;}
    .montlytabpanel .table .form-control{min-width: 80px;}
    .registerfrom{padding-left: 50px;}
    .registercol{padding: 50px 0px;}
    .registerowsection {padding: 30px 0px;align-items: center;}
    
    
}
@media only screen and (max-width:1024px) {
    
   
}

/*iPad Landscape, iPad Pro Portrait end*/

/*Tablet start*/

@media only screen and (max-width:992px) {
    .usernamecol{display: none;}
    .usericon{margin-right: 0px;}
    .logo{width: 130px;} 
    .navbar-collapse{width: 50%;}
    .leftcolumn{margin-bottom: 30px;}
    .loginfrm {padding: 0px 50px;}
    .logologin{margin-bottom: 30px;}
    .loginfrm a{margin-top: 2px;}
    .topbuttonpanel .row [class*="col-"] a{margin-bottom: 10px;}
    .registerfrom{padding-left: 30px}
    .regleftcol{padding-right: 30px}
    .registercol{padding: 50px;}
    .frmborderleft h1{font-size: 20px;}
    .logorgister img{width: 180px;}
    
}

@media only screen and (max-width:991px) {
   
   
}


/*Tablet end*/

/*Tablet start*/

@media only screen and (max-width:980px) {

}

/*Tablet end*/

/*Tablet start*/

@media only screen and (max-width:960px) {
  
   
}

/*Tablet end*/

/*Nokia N9 Landscape start*/

@media only screen and (max-width:854px) {
   
    .navmenu{width: 75%;}
    .breadcrumb{justify-content: flex-start;}
}

/*Nokia N9 Landscape end*/

/*Pixel 2 XL Landscape start*/

@media only screen and (max-width:823px) {}

/*Pixel 2 XL Landscape end*/

/*iPhone X Landscape start*/

@media only screen and (max-width:812px) {}

/*iPhone X Landscape end*/

/*Kindle Fire HDX, Nexux 10 start*/

@media only screen and (max-width:800px) {}

/*Kindle Fire HDX, Nexux 10 end*/

/*iPad Portrait start*/

@media only screen and (max-width:768px) {
   
}
@media (min-width:767px) and (max-width:812px) and (max-height: 375px) {
   
}
@media only screen and (max-width:767px) {
    .loginrow.vh-100{height: auto !important;}
    .loginfrm{padding: 30px;}
}

/*iPad Portrait end*/

/*iPhone 6/7/8 Plus Landscape start*/

@media only screen and (max-width:736px) {}

/*iPhone 6/7/8 Plus Landscape end*/

/*Pixel 2 Landscape start*/

@media only screen and (max-width:731px) {}

/*Pixel 2 Landscape end*/

/*iPhone 6/7/8 Landscape start*/

@media only screen and (max-width:667px) {}

/*iPhone 6/7/8 Landscape end*/

/*Galaxy Note 3 Landscape start*/

@media only screen and (max-width:640px) {}

/*Galaxy Note 3 Landscape end*/

/*Smartphone start*/

@media only screen and (max-width:604px) {}

/*Smartphone end*/

/*Blackberry PlayBook, Nexus 7 start*/

@media only screen and (max-width:600px) {}

@media only screen and (max-width:580px) {
   
    .navmenu {width: 100%; }
  
}

/*Blackberry PlayBook, Nexus 7 end*/

@media only screen and (max-width:575px) {
    
}

/*iPhone 5/SE Landscape start*/

@media only screen and (max-width:568px) {}

/*iPhone 5/SE Landscape end*/

/*Nokia Lumia 520 Landscape start*/

@media only screen and (max-width:533px) {}

/*Nokia Lumia 520 Landscape end*/

/*Nokia N9 start*/

@media only screen and (max-width:480px) {
    
}

/*Nokia N9 end*/

/*iPhone 6/7/8 Plus start*/

@media only screen and (max-width:414px) {
    
}

/*iPhone 6/7/8 Plus end*/

/*Nexus 6 start*/

@media only screen and (max-width:412px) {}

/*Nexus 6 end*/

/*Pixel 2XL start*/

@media only screen and (max-width:411px) {}

/*Pixel 2XL end*/

/*LG Optimus L70, Nexus 4 start*/

@media only screen and (max-width:384px) {
  
   
   
  
}

/*LG Optimus L70, Nexus 4 end*/

/*iPhone 6/7/8 Plus, iPhone X start*/

@media only screen and (max-width:375px) {}

/*iPhone 6/7/8 Plus, iPhone X end*/

/*Galaxy S5, Galaxy Note, Galaxy Note 3, Nexus 5, BlackBerry, Microsoft Lumia start*/

@media only screen and (max-width:360px) {
    
   
}

/*Galaxy S5, Galaxy Note, Galaxy Note 3, Nexus 5, BlackBerry, Microsoft Lumia end*/

/*iPhone 5/SE, iPhone 4, Nokia Lumia 520 start*/

@media only screen and (max-width:320px) {}

/*iPhone 5/SE, iPhone 4, Nokia Lumia 520 end*/